Installation / Setup

The source document provides detailed information on the installation and setup of the Kenwood TK-7180H/7182H radios. Key highlights include:

1. Pre-Installation Considerations:
– Unpack the radio and check for all accessory items.
– Ensure compliance with licensing requirements for radio installation.
– Perform a pre-installation checkout to verify receiver and transmitter operation.

2. Planning the Installation:
– Inspect the vehicle for suitable locations for mounting the radio antenna and accessories.
– Plan cable runs to avoid pinching or crushing wires and ensure proper radio cooling.
– The antenna should ideally be mounted at the center of a large, flat conductive area, such as the roof or trunk lid, with proper grounding.

3. Radio Mounting:
– Use the universal mount bracket to secure the radio, ensuring the mounting surface can support its weight and allows for sufficient air cooling.
– Position the radio for easy access to controls by the vehicle operator.

4. DC Power and Wiring:
– The radio is designed for negative ground electrical systems only.
– Connect the positive power lead directly to the vehicle battery’s positive terminal and the ground lead to the battery’s negative terminal.
– Ensure any extended cable is capable of handling the radio’s current demand.

5. Control Stations:
– Antenna system selection is crucial and should be discussed with a Kenwood dealer for optimal performance.
– Choose a radio location close to the antenna cable entry point for convenience.

Safety & Warnings

The following precautions are recommended for personal safety:

– Do not transmit if someone is within two feet (0.6 meter) of the antenna.
– Do not transmit until all RF connectors are secure and any open connectors are properly terminated.
– Shut off this equipment when near electrical blasting caps or while in an explosive atmosphere.
– All equipment should be properly grounded before power-up for safe operation.
– This equipment should be serviced by only qualified technicians.
